Our timeline
-
2023
Jan
Introduced paperless invoicing, saving over 400,000 pieces of paper (approximately 1 tonne or 30–40 trees), while beginning to map our Tier 1 & 2 supply chain.
-
2023
March
Invested in more responsible operations at our distribution centre, including the installation of solar panels and spot wash and ozone technology to support more efficient garment processing.
-
2023
May
Strengthened our circularity and waste-reduction efforts through partnerships with Brown Recycling Ltd (recycling 100% of cardboard and paper), Duo (responsibly sourced, 100% recyclable return and mailing bags, plus a recycling plan), and Green IT for the recycling of all IT equipment.
-
2023
August
Enhanced both customer experience and product longevity by introducing an accessibility tool on site, alongside our product aftercare page and Refund for Repair option.
Partnered with DPD and Royal Mail to offer more sustainable delivery options for UK customers.
-
2023
Nov
Strengthened governance across our supply chain by introducing our Supplier Code of Conduct and UK & EU REACH Compliance Policy, while re-evaluating inbound shipping to achieve a 20% increase in sea freight compared to 2022.
-
2024
Jan
Established our official Depop page for pre-loved styles and one-off samples as part of our circular fashion journey.
Renewed our Simplyhealth employee benefits following strong engagement in 2023.
-
2024
March
Continued our growth by increasing our supply chain by 35% compared to 2023 and streamlining labels and packaging sourcing by appointing a single supplier.
Continued international expansion with the introduction of localised sites in the UAE, Canada and Spain.
-
2024
Sept
Shortlisted at the Drapers Awards for Womenswear Brand of the Year, Pureplay of the Year and International Excellence, while also introducing our first influencer collection in collaboration with Leonie Hanne.
-
2024
Nov
Our Depop page surpassed 10,000 items sold in under one year, reinforcing our commitment to circular fashion.
In support of lower-impact delivery, DPD reported a saving of 9,208 kg CO2 in 2024 through its electric delivery programme.
-
2025
Feb
Announced the acquisition of Lavish Alice, welcoming the brand into the Club L family, while continuing international growth with the introduction of localised sites in Saudi Arabia.
-
2025
March
Became a Retail Week Awards 2025 nominee for The Fashion Retailer of the Year Award, while increasing our supplychain by25% compared to 2024.
-
2025
April
Partnered with TDAS (Trafford Domestic Abuse Services) and took part in the Manchester 10K to raise funds in support of their work.
Increased our Trustpilot score to 4.6, while our Depop shop surpassed 20,000 units sold, representing 100% growth in six months.
-
2025
Aug
Established our first 3PL in the USA to improve regional service and support a lower carbon footprint, while continuing international expansion with the addition of localised sites in Germany, the Netherlands and Poland.
-
2025
Dec
Our delivery partners, Royal Mail reported a reduction in emissions from 178g CO2 per parcel (2024) to 165gCO2e per parcel (2025).
